■ Basic Operations

Camera Recording

Make sure that the power source is installed and a cassette is inserted. If you set the date (p. 12). the

date is automatically recorded tor 10 seconds after you start recording (AUTO DATE feature) This
feature works only once a day. You can use the Remote Commander to record yourself with your friends
or family. When you use the Remote Commander, make sure that the REMOTE COMMANDER switch on

the camcorder is set to ON (p. 43).
Before you record one-time events, you may want to make a trial recording to make sure that the

camcorder is working perfectly. (1) Slide the LENS COVER switch to OPEN. (2) While pressing the small

green button on the POWER switch, slide it to CAMERA. (3) Set the PROGRAM AE dial: [a] When using a
monochrome viewfinder, pull out the viewfinder until it clicks, and set the white mark of the PROGRAM AE

dial to the green position,

[b]

When using a color viewfinder, set the white mark of the PROGRAM AE

dial to the green position. (4) Turn the STANDBY switch to STANDBY. Adjust the viewfinder lens so that
the indicators in the viewfinder come into sharp focus (p. 14). (S) Press START/STOP. The camcorder
starts recording and the red lamp lights up in the viewfinder.

To Stop Recording Momentarily

Press START/STOP again. The "STBY" indicator appears in the viewfinder (Standby moda).

To Finish Recording

Turn the STANDBY switch to LOCK and slide the POWER switch to OFF. Slide the LENS COVER switch to

CLOSE and eject the tape (p. 13).

Notes on Standby mode

If you leave the camcorder in Standby mode lor 5 minutes, the camcorder goes off automatically. This
prevents wearing down the battery and wearing out the tape. To resume Standby mode, turn the

STANDBY switch to LOCK once and turn it to STANDBY again. To start recording, press START/STOP.
